Bürgerschützenfest — edition 2026
From August 22 to 24, 2026, the Allgemeine Bürgerschützenverein St. Georg e.V. will celebrate its Bürgerschützenfest in the Stadtpark Vreden. The 2026 King couple — Elisabeth van den Berg and Ewald Hollekamp — will lead the court. Saturday opens the festival tent with the Zapfenstreich and a grand Shooting Club Ball. Sunday's highlight is the grand parade through Vreden's city center, followed by the King's Coronation Ceremony and a festival evening. On Monday, the new King couple for 2026/2027 will be chosen and crowned at the King's Shoot at the Vogel. With 11 active shooting clubs, Vreden is one of the towns in Westphalia with the most shooting festivals.

Practical information — Bürgerschützenfest
Getting There
By car: Take the A31 exit Gronau-Süd, then follow the B70 to Vreden. By bus & train: Ahaus station, then take bus R 75 or the Ahaus-Express to Vreden. From the Netherlands: easily accessible via Winterswijk or Aalten. Parking available around the Stadtpark.
Admission
Parades and social gatherings: free. Shooting Club Ball on Saturday and festival evenings: admission varies by event (approx. €10-€20). King's Shoot on Monday is open to the public.

Tip
For the full program experience, come on Sunday for the parade and on Monday for the King's Shoot. For the King's Shoot at the Vogel: an exciting moment when the last splinter of wood falls and the new King couple is determined.

11 Shooting Clubs in Vreden in 2026
With 11 active shooting clubs, Vreden is one of the richest towns in Westphalia for shooting festivals. Various city districts, rural communities, and associations celebrate their own shooting festivals throughout the season. The Bürgerschützenfest of the Allgemeine Bürgerschützenverein St. Georg is one of the most important — a central, city-wide event in the Stadtpark.
2026 King Couple — Already Chosen
At the 2025 shooting festival, the new majesties for the 2025/2026 season were crowned:
- King 2026: Ewald Hollekamp
- Queen 2026: Elisabeth van den Berg
The couple leads the court and is the official representation of the club throughout the festival year — until the new King couple for 2026/2027 is determined at the 2026 King's Shoot.

Stadtpark Vreden — The Festival Grounds
The Stadtpark Vreden is the green heart of the town — a park and recreational area that offers the ideal backdrop for major events like the Bürgerschützenfest. The festival tent, the Vogelstange (target pole) for the King's Shoot, catering, and ample space for hundreds of shooters and thousands of guests come together here. Its location in the heart of Vreden makes it easily accessible on foot from most parts of the city.
Vreden — The Town on the Dutch Border
Vreden (around 23,000 inhabitants) is located in the Borken district, directly on the border with the Netherlands. The town has a long history as a market town and religious center of the Westmünsterland region; with the St. Felicitas Collegiate Church and the kult Westmünsterland (local history museum), Vreden boasts remarkable cultural institutions. The proximity to the Dutch border also brings cross-border visitor flows — especially during major events like the Bürgerschützenfest.
The St. Georg Tradition
The Allgemeine Bürgerschützenverein St. Georg bears the name of the patron saint of shooters — Saint George, the dragon slayer. This choice of patron is widespread in the Münsterland and Sauerland regions and underscores the shooting club's Catholic roots, even though modern clubs have long been open to all denominations.
